What Is A Normal D-dimer In Pregnancy?

During pregnancy, there are various physiological changes that occur in a woman’s body to support the growing fetus. These changes also extend to certain blood parameters, including D-dimer levels. D-dimer is a protein fragment that is produced when a blood clot dissolves in the body. Measuring D-dimer levels is essential in assessing the risk of blood clot formation in individuals, including pregnant women.

First Trimester D-Dimer Levels

In the first trimester of pregnancy, the normal reference range for D-dimer levels is between 167-721 ng/mL. This range accounts for the changes in blood coagulation that naturally occur during early pregnancy. It is important to note that individual variations may exist, and healthcare providers will consider various factors when interpreting D-dimer results in pregnant women.

Second Trimester D-Dimer Levels

As pregnancy progresses into the second trimester, D-dimer levels tend to increase. The normal reference range for D-dimer levels in the second trimester is approximately 298-1653 ng/mL. These higher levels are expected due to the increased blood volume and circulation demands of the developing fetus.

Third Trimester D-Dimer Levels

By the third trimester of pregnancy, D-dimer levels continue to rise within a range of 483-2256 ng/mL. The peak in D-dimer levels during this stage of pregnancy reflects the culmination of hemostatic changes and increased clotting factors in preparation for childbirth. These elevated levels are considered within the normal range for pregnant women.

Monitoring D-Dimer Levels in Pregnancy

Healthcare providers closely monitor D-dimer levels throughout pregnancy to assess the risk of thromboembolic events, such as deep vein thrombosis or pulmonary embolism. Abnormal D-dimer levels may warrant further evaluation and possible intervention to prevent potentially life-threatening complications for both the mother and the developing baby.

Comparing D-Dimer and Fibrinogen Levels

While D-dimer levels reflect ongoing fibrinolysis and the breakdown of blood clots, fibrinogen levels indicate the body’s ability to form blood clots. In pregnancy, both D-dimer and fibrinogen levels play crucial roles in maintaining hemostatic balance and preventing excessive bleeding or clotting complications.

Clinical Significance of D-Dimer Testing

D-Dimer testing is a valuable tool in the evaluation of suspected thrombotic events in pregnant women. Elevated D-dimer levels may indicate the presence of an active clotting process, prompting further diagnostic testing to confirm the diagnosis and initiate appropriate treatment to protect maternal and fetal health.
